Jaszy McAllister

jaszy, head honcho

Jaszy McAllister is the driving force behind MHMag. Her desire to give voice and document her own personal eco-journey and discovery was the basis of creating Modern Hippie Mag. Outside of being the Editor in Chief, Jaszy is a spokesperson, host, model, actress, and self-professed workaholic, computer junkie. She enjoys good food, good company and dancing her tushy off at local Latin dance clubs. Find her on Twitter, @msjaszy or network with her on LinkedIn. Read articles by Jaszy. adwoa, mng editor

Originally from gorgeous Sarasota, Florida, Adwoa Gyimah-Brempong has recently returned (like a sea turtle) to the beaches of her birth. The Florida native has traveled widely, living most recently in New England, Portugal and Italy. A dedicated communications maven, Adwoa is a veteran of Gilt City, TimeOut Boston, and MIT. Her interests range from food to fashion, music to policy – all underscored by the certainty that it’s possible to live a rich, fulfilling life while treading lightly on the earth. Shayna Teicher

shayna, beyond beauty editor

Shayna’s foray down the rabbit hole and into the often upside-down world of beauty products began at the tender age of six, when she pilfered her mother’s singular bottle of L’oreal nail polish and gave herself (and part of the carpet) her first pedicure. A self-educated recovering product-junkie, Shayna set out to pare down the clutter of abandoned beauty products taking over her bathroom (and dresser, and closet) in lieu of a more consolidated, effective collection of beauty essentials. After nearly three years managing a bath and beauty boutique, Shayna decided to go out on her own and open Butterfly Effect, a holistic, eco-conscious beauty boutique located in Sarasota, Florida. steve, lifestyle guru

Steve McAllister describes himself as a Renaissance Man. An author, filmmaker, songwriter, and perpetual artistic experimenter, he has recently re-released his second book The Rucksack Letters into paperback to celebrate the 10th anniversary of the journey. A journey of ink and soul, the book recounts his year and a half trek through 26 states, exploring the underbelly of America in order to better know himself. nadya, wellness warrior

Nadya Andreeva is a yoga instructor and ayurveda enthusiast who grew up in Russia in a family of doctors. Nadya grew up practicing yoga and learning about different healing approaches in Russia, India, and later all over the US. Trained in yoga, wellness coaching, and ayurveda, Nadya works to create a wholesome path to wellness through yoga classes, personal wellness coaching, and nutrition workshops. She teaches yoga at Strala Yoga in NYC and leads workshops on Healthy Grocery Shopping. Julie Urlaub is the Founder & Managing Partner of Taiga Company, a sustainability consulting firm located in Houston, Texas dedicated to accelerating the integration of sustainability concepts in business.  Julie leverages over 15 years of Consulting and Business Development experience in Energy Management Services, Oil and Gas, Medical, and Information Technology industries with small and large organizations. Today, Julie speaks, writes, and advises clients on a variety of issues related to the intersection between environmental stewardship, sustainable business practices, and the bottom-line benefits of sustainability strategies. Lynn Stone is a wife and mother of two, and founder of the go-to green living blog for parents, smilinggreenmom.com. Her passion and enthusiasm for helping her readers take steps toward living a greener, healthier and more natural life began when her family had to make changes in their household because of her son’s severe food allergies. Since dramatically altering what products and practices she uses in her household, she has seen a remarkable change in the quality of life of not only her son, but of her entire family. Being a mom of two, Lynn understands the constraints of budgets and schedules, and encourages her readers to simply be “as green as they can be.” Her enthusiastic and upbeat posts cover a wide range of tips and products that she recommends for families looking to take small steps toward achieving their green goals! Lori Popkewitz Alper is the founder of Groovy Green Livin, a site dedicated to sharing green living tips and information with individuals, families, schools and businesses. A contributing writer for multiple blogs and websites, Lori speaks, writes and advises clients on a variety of issues related to creating a greener lifestyle. Lori is a green living educator, consultant, mother to three young boys and a chocolate lab, borderline vegan and recovering attorney.
